Output dd2a16c389f22af36fc8fd05a2d5c2eec047e505a293a4e8038fe7fe3d01993a:7

value
336217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7756bfe9be667823473edd54808b0fa3ce208709 OP_EQUAL
address
3Ca2FqtHGZT1Mj2G34VsPkhAt1CwJ5htgL
transaction
dd2a16c389f22af36fc8fd05a2d5c2eec047e505a293a4e8038fe7fe3d01993a
spent
true